I have info on Christina's parents and siblings from the book "Highgate, MO: The First 125 Years," Peter Mikkelsen (1830-1887) was born in Osterlinnet, Schlesvig, Denmark, the elder son of Hans Mikkelsen ( - 1836) and Christina Mikkelsen ( -1863). Peter Mikkelsen (1830-1887) married Anna Schmidt (1825-1896) and they with their seven children left Denmark in 1872 for America, first settled in Gasconade County, Missouri, where he was a rope maker, then moved on to Maries County where he died. He and his wife are both buried at the old Highgate Cemetery. They were the parents of Hans Mikkelsen (1856-1930), Anna Marea Mikkelsen Rasmussen (1857- 1888), twins Christina Mikkelsen Skouby (1861-1928) and Jens Mikkelsen (1861-1866), Charley Martin Mikkelsen (1864-1956), Anna Martin Mikkelsen Dawson (1866-1923), Peter Hansen Mikkelsen (1869-about 1898), Hans Jergen (Jerd) Mikkelsen (1859-1948). Anna Schmidt (1825-1896) second married H. Rasmussen. Christina Mikkelsen (1861-1928) married Otto P. Skouby (1857-1891), and they were the parents of Hans Petersen Skouby (1886-1950) who married Gerdie Love (1887-1956), Peter Mikkelsen Skouby (1888-1965) married Jessye Burnside (1896-1970), Ottie Kathryn Skouby (1891-1983) who married Jernsen P.
